Part Overview
The B5741-206-F-N-2 is a 6-position receptacle connector from Harwin Inc.'s Datamate L-Tek series, designed for board-to-board or cable applications with 0.079" (2.00mm) pitch spacing. This connector features through-hole solder termination, gold-plated contacts, and is rated for 3A at 120V across operating temperatures from -55°C to 125°C. The part is currently obsolete, making identification of compatible substitute components essential for ongoing system support and new design implementations.

Substitute Part Grouping Explanation
The M80-8500645 qualifies as a direct substitute for the B5741-206-F-N-2 based on the following critical parameters:
- Identical connector type (receptacle) and contact type (female socket)
- Matching position count (6 positions) and row configuration (2 rows)
- Identical pitch spacing (0.079" / 2.00mm) for both mating and row spacing
- Same mounting method (through hole) and termination type (solder)
- Identical contact material (beryllium copper) and mating contact finish (gold)
- Matching operating temperature range (-55°C to 125°C)
- Same material flammability rating (UL94 V-0)
- Same series designation (Datamate L-Tek)
The M80-8500645 represents an active product status replacement for the obsolete B5741-206-F-N-2, with enhanced compliance and higher voltage rating capability.

Engineering Selection Recommendations
The M80-8500645 is the appropriate substitute for the obsolete B5741-206-F-N-2. Both connectors maintain identical mechanical and electrical compatibility across all critical mating parameters, ensuring direct interchangeability in existing PCB designs and cable assemblies.
The M80-8500645 offers significant advantages for new designs and ongoing support:
- Active product status ensures long-term availability and supply chain continuity
- ROHS3 compliance meets current environmental and regulatory requirements, whereas the B5741-206-F-N-2 is RoHS non-compliant
- Elevated voltage rating (800V versus 120V) provides enhanced capability for higher-voltage applications while maintaining backward compatibility with 120V designs
- Identical contact post length specifications (0.118" / 3.00mm) and mating contact geometry ensure mechanical fit within existing assemblies
For applications currently using the B5741-206-F-N-2, transition to M80-8500645 requires no PCB layout modifications or mechanical redesign.
